Remember when Overhaul criticized Shiragaki for treating minions that had a lot of potential to be useful as disposable?

That sure looks super hypocritical now, doesn't it?

It's not like he was saying to value his minions' lives or anything, just to use them more effectively. When Overhaul loses people, it's because he's sacrificing them for a purpose, like "keep the hand guy from hitting me with his quirk" or "stall the big ol' mob of heroes long enough that I can do whatever it is I'm doing here." When Shiragaki loses people - including Mag-nee, who goes down after Overhaul gives that spiel about how Shiragaki doesn't plan shit - the reason behind it is "whoops."

Well, Stain's an exception there since his defeat helped build the Villain Alliance's rep, but riding his coattails sure wasn't Shiragaki's plan. Not that Overhaul would be likely to know about Shiragaki getting pissy about Stain overshadowing him, granted. But anyway, the Stain situation may be weird, but other than that I think Overhaul's got a point.

The chances of Eri getting recused are somewhat lower than Overhaul going down, because I can envision an ending where she falls into Shriagaki's hands in order to keep the whole quirk-stealing bullet plot thread going.
I was thinking the odds were the other way around, myself. I could see Overhaul escaping with some pawns and anti-quirk bullets and the narrative using the fact that he got away from this giant operation targeting him specifically to maintain his villain cred. But if Eri doesn't get rescued, then Deku's takeaway after all this buildup is basically "you once again failed to save the little girl having pieces of her flesh gouged out, hero," and that seems kinda bleak for this story.
